Peet Welthagen reacted to Scorp007 in Adding solar panels to existing onesGreat advice from @GreenFields
No need to change the panels. Even if 1 MPPT is working at say 18A instead of the 22A maximum it is a major saving retaining those 250W panels. There will always be someone interested in the 21st panel. Also although newer inverters have a lot more bells and whistles and extract more energy I would also not change the working Axperts just to get comms to work.
Although voltage settings don't work as well with lithium I am also using lithiums this way and works well for me. There might just be a bit of estimated SOC instead of getting the exact %.

Peet Welthagen reacted to GreenFields in Adding solar panels to existing onesSurely lots of people must be successfully running lithium ion batteries on Axperts using the voltage parameters, and the expected lifespan should still be much higher than for the previous lead acid batteries. Just not sure if that is the right reason to be replacing inverters if they are perfectly functional and serving your needs. The lead acid is just a technology with a lower expected lifespan, and that's not the fault of the inverter.
